Abstract

The author studies wall-paintings, dated on XVIII century, of the Remedios Church in Vélez-Málaga. Their iconography remains royal exaltation of Felipe V, first King of Bourbonian Dinasty in Spain, conquering Spanish Succession War, by the Town-Council of Vélez. After those, several paintings about Virgin Mary's lífe were made in the temple.
